深入了解 NFT 代币标准和最佳安全实践

图片

阅读时间: 4 分钟

在这个数字时代,我们中的大多数人已经开始着手寻找投资区块链设置的方法。 这是因为它可以针对当前需求提供的解决方案引起了用户的敬畏。 

说到这一点,不可替代的代币,通常被称为 NFT,与作为数字代币交易的所有权特权融合在一起——一种独一无二的资产。 让我们对这个主题有所了解,以破译 NFT 代币标准并审计最佳实践以保护它们。

使用中的 NFT 代币标准

我们将看到一个常见的列表 NFT 标准 以及它们的基础属性。 

ERC-721 – 最常见的一个

ERC-20 是基本标准,但本质上是可替代的。 它们具有共同的功能并且可以互换。 这些代币不适合表达物品的所有权,代表了它的独特价值。 然后出现了 ERC-721 标准来解决这个问题。 

ERC-721 本质上是有限的、独特的和不可分割的。 他们证明最常用于创建游戏 NFT 的数字资产或现实世界项目的所有权。 ERC-721 在区块链游戏中应用最为广泛

限制:高交易费用和有限的数据存储。 由于 gas 成本很高,这对铸造多个 ERC-721 NFT 提出了挑战。

ERC-1155 – 捆绑交易

ERC-1155 是 ERC-721 的扩展,以克服捆绑交易的高交易费用。 它具有扩展以添加可替代和不可替代令牌的能力。 

它为想要一次性出售大量 NFT 的用户提供了便利。 该标准允许发布单个 NFT 的多个副本。 

示例:在 NFT 游戏中,用户可以使用采用单个智能合约的 ERC-1155 交易多个游戏项目。 

限制:ERC-1155 存储的信息不太可靠,用于存储时间和交易成本。 

BEP-721 – ERC-721 的变体 

BEP-721 在 Binace 智能链上运行,每个代币都是独一无二的,不能与另一个代币互换。 它与 ERC-721 相同,需要支付 gas 费。 

ERC-998 – 多个 ERC-721 和 ERC-20 代币的父代币

ERC 998 充当可以存储 ERC-721 和 ERC-20 的父代币。 在购买游戏角色的情况下,可穿戴设备和配件都是通过ERC 998获得的。 

EIP-1948 – 修改 NFT 数据

EIP-1948 也是 ERC-721 的扩展,但允许更改信息。 在 ERC-721 中,铸币期间提供的数据不能更改或修改,但该标准提供了存储动态数据的能力。 

它有一个 32 字节的数据字段,具有写入功能,所有者可以在其中更新。 例如,在 NFT 游戏中,玩家可以使用它来自定义他们的玩家。 

一些备受关注的 NFT

合并

由数字艺术家 Pak 创建的 The Merge 是一系列 NFT,被 28,983 人以 91.8 万美元的价格购买。 这件艺术品在 Nifty Gateway 上被出售,短时间内就有大量买家围绕着这件艺术品。

每天:前5000天

数字艺术家 Mike Beeple Winkelmann 以 69.3 万美元的价格卖出了“Everydays”数字艺术作品。 艺术是 5000 张照片的拼贴画,每天制作一张,持续了 XNUMX 年。 每张图片都是以描绘当前事件或个人信息的主题创建的。  

时钟

名为“时钟”的 NFT 是维基解密创始人朱利安·阿桑奇和帕尔的创作,描绘了阿桑奇在狱中度过的日子的数字计数器。 NFT 以 52.7 万美元的价格出售,并被资助用于阿桑奇的辩护。 

人一

人类再次成为 Beeple 的创作之一,在佳士得拍卖会上以高达 28.9 万美元的价格成交。 Human One 是在元宇宙中出生的人类的肖像,艺术品是物理和数字技术的混合体。

加密朋克#5822

该项目由 Larva Labs 发布,该实验室收集了 10,000 个朋克,其中 CryptoPunk #5822 的售价约为 23.7 万美元。 这是该系列中最稀有的外星人版本,因为只有 9 个存在。 

NFT 安全性发生了什么?

案件 NFT 盗窃 随着 NFT 的日益普及,它们也在不断增加。 所以,这里有一个关于如何确保 NFT 项目安全的后续内容。 

重入可能性: 重入是一种程序执行中断的情况,外部合同耗尽了原始合同中的资金。 因此,在启动 NFT 项目时,必须对其进行检查。

代币兼容性: 确保代币可转让并与不同的钱包兼容

安全检查: 运行验证检查以测试无限循环条件、gas 使用、第三方库、修改器、交易失败等。 

算术检查: 针对最小值到最大值、小数平衡、安全数学等计算变量溢出。

指南验证: 验证令牌是根据 ERC-721 标准创建的,并针对具有不正确令牌 ID 的非重复令牌生成进行测试。 

坚固版本: 根据使用的solidity 版本,将检查其各自导入的库是否符合ERC-721 合约。

甲骨文: 检查 oracle 服务并确保采用最佳实践。 

QuillAudits 如何在提供安全性方面脱颖而出?

我们审计了 600 多个 DeFi 和 NFT 项目,我们在该领域的专业知识使我们成为领先的区块链安全公司。 我们的服务范围从防止 NFT 伪造到检查铸造过程中的差距等等!

立即与我们的安全专家取得联系,以获得有关 Web3 审计服务的广泛知识。 

95 观点

时间戳记:

更多来自 散列